Analysis

In 2024, printing and writing papers, coated β€” import value in Angola stood at 1,942 1000 USD.

Compared with earlier readings it is down 65.9% on the previous year and down 68.1% over ten years.

Over the whole period, printing and writing papers, coated β€” import value in Angola peaked at 6,636 1000 USD in 2019 and was at its lowest, 58 1000 USD, in 2002.

That places Angola 132nd out of 220 countries with data for 2024, putting it in the middle of the range.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
